3. Garden Shed with Green Roof

A garden shed with a green roof brings nature into your backyard while enhancing sustainability. The green roof is covered with plants, creating a mini ecosystem and offering insulation benefits.
This shed design blends beautifully with the natural environment, providing a seamless transition between your shed and garden. The green roof also absorbs rainwater, reducing runoff and promoting eco-friendly living. It’s an ideal choice for garden enthusiasts looking to incorporate sustainability into their backyard.
